As a Card Fraud Analyst on our team, you will:

  • Be the first contact handling card fraud disputes raised by customers, understanding the fraud or scam event that has impacted the customers.
  • Handle escalations from customer support or other internal teams, creating disputes on behalf of customers where applicable, and understanding the fraud or scam event that has impacted the customers.
  • Direct incorrect escalations in the card fraud inbox to the correct internal teams.
  • Combine multiple ongoing disputes from a single customer and investigating them as part of a single fraud event.
  • Determine the true impact of the fraud event and add any unreported fraud transactions to the customers’ disputes.
  • Credit the customer in a timely manner (end to end speed).
  • List down factors supporting the deactivation or refund refusal decision and submitting deactivations for double approval by an internal agent.
  • Be able to independently own deactivations after 3-6 months of agent experience.
  • Conversing with customers in a succinct, respectful manner to ensure customer satisfaction and avoid customer complaints.
  • Make swift and accurate investigations internally (reviewing disputers’ accounts/activities) and externally (using adverse media).

As a Card Dispute Analyst on our team, you will:

  • Review the cardholder dispute form and answers from the customer response to understand the case
  • Get in touch with the customer via email regarding the case
  • Review the ‘similar transactions’ list to see how often the customer has been charged
  • Review the ‘similar transactions’ list for refund
  • Mark the status of the case: need more info, invalid, valid, already refunded or escalate according to the card dispute procedure
  • Create documentation when needed to support if case is valid and ready for a chargeback to be filed
